CAUTION:
Connect the positive lead to the battery
terminal first.
Make sure the battery leads are con-
nected properly. Reversing the leads can
seriously damage the electrical system.
Make sure that the battery breather hose is
properly connected and is not obstructed.
Coat the terminals with a water resistant
grease to minimize terminal corrosion.

JET PUMP UNIT

Impeller inspection

1. Check:
Impeller 1
Damage/wear → Replace.
Nicks/scratches → File or grind.
2. Measure:
Impeller-to-housing clearance a
Out of specification → Replace.
Max. impeller-to-housing
clearance:
0.6 mm (0.02 in)
Measurement steps:
Remove the battery leads.
Remove the intake grate 1 and intake
duct 2.
Measure the clearance at each impel-
ler blade as shown (a total of three
measurements).
Install the intake grate and intake duct.
Bolt:
M6: 7 N • m
(0.7 kgf • m, 5.1 ft • lb)
M8: 17 N • m
(1.7 kgf • m, 12 ft • lb)
Install the battery leads.
